Criminal Justice Wages Near Logan

Logan is part of the Logan, UT-ID metro area (BLS area code 30860).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Utah statewide.

OccupationMedian WageSourceCOL-Adjusted (US=100)
Attorney$97,410Logan, UT-ID$101,575
Judge or Magistrate$123,640UT statewide$128,926
Police Supervisor$84,630Logan, UT-ID$88,248
Detective or Criminal Investigator$74,530UT statewide$77,716
Police or Sheriff’s Patrol Officer$63,600Logan, UT-ID$66,319
Correctional Officer$61,340UT statewide$63,962
Probation Officer$74,860UT statewide$78,060
Forensic Science Technician$64,430UT statewide$67,185
Paralegal or Legal Assistant$46,820Logan, UT-ID$48,822
Information Security Analyst$120,800Logan, UT-ID$125,965

Source: BLS, May 2024 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.

How do I verify a program is accredited?

Confirm institutional accreditation via the U.S. Department of Education database (U.S. Dept. of Education database), and check for any program-specific accreditation listed by the school.
